Why Choose Finger Mehndi Designs?

Mehndi, also called henna, has been used for centuries to decorate the skin. While full-hand mehndi designs are traditional, finger mehndi offers a more modern and minimalistic option. These designs are perfect if you’re looking for something stylish yet subtle.

Benefits of Finger Mehndi Designs:

  • Versatility: Suitable for casual wear, festivals, and even bridal events.
  • Quick Application: Finger designs take less time than full-hand mehndi.
  • Elegant and Minimalist: Ideal for those who prefer a simple and stylish look.
  • Suitable for All Ages: Perfect for kids, teens, and adults alike.

Popular Styles of Finger Mehndi Designs

1. Minimalist Finger Mehndi Designs

Minimalist finger mehndi designs are all about clean and simple patterns like dots, lines, or tiny floral motifs. These are great if you want a delicate and understated look. Inspired by Arabic mehndi, these designs focus on minimal strokes and are perfect for casual events.

2. Floral Finger Mehndi Designs

Floral patterns are a timeless favorite, especially for finger mehndi. You can opt for small flowers with connecting vines or even a single large flower on each finger. Floral designs are elegant and can be used for both casual and festive occasions.

3. Geometric Pattern Finger Mehndi Designs

For a modern and unique look, geometric patterns like triangles, diamonds, and hexagons work wonders. Combined with straight lines or dots, geometric mehndi is perfect for those who want something bold and contemporary.

4. Ring Style Finger Mehndi Design

This style mimics the look of rings on your fingers. The patterns wrap around your finger, resembling the placement of stacked rings. These designs are very popular among brides and wedding guests for their decorative and elegant look.

5. Mandala-Inspired Finger Mehndi Designs

Mandalas, with their intricate circular designs, symbolize balance and eternity. When applied on fingers, these designs offer a spiritual and artistic look. Mandala-inspired finger mehndi often includes dots, lines, and smaller geometric shapes for a balanced design.

Finger Mehndi Designs for Different Occasions

Bridal Finger Mehndi

Brides often choose detailed and ornate finger mehndi designs that complement their jewelry and outfit. While some prefer full-hand mehndi, others go for intricate finger designs, incorporating floral motifs, paisleys, and vines.

Festive Finger Mehndi

Festivals like Diwali, Eid, and Karva Chauth call for elaborate and festive mehndi. These designs feature bold lines, heavy shading, and intricate details, making them perfect for special occasions without covering the entire hand.

Casual Finger Mehndi

If you love mehndi for everyday wear, casual designs are your best bet. These are simple patterns like dots, small flowers, or basic lines that you can easily apply at home. They add a stylish touch without being time-consuming.

Tips for Long-Lasting Finger Mehndi

To make sure your mehndi lasts longer and appears darker, follow these tips:

  1. Clean your hands: Ensure your fingers are clean and oil-free before applying mehndi.
  2. Leave it for 6-8 hours: The longer the paste stays on your skin, the darker it will get.
  3. Avoid water for a few hours: After removing the paste, avoid water contact for at least a few hours.
  4. Use natural henna: Natural henna gives a darker and longer-lasting stain compared to chemical-based henna.

Pairing Finger Mehndi with Jewelry

Pairing finger mehndi with statement rings or nail art is a great way to elevate your look. A combination of intricate mehndi designs and bold jewelry can make your hands stand out at any event. If your mehndi design is minimalistic, opt for heavier rings to balance the look. For more detailed designs, go for simpler, delicate jewelry.
